Salvini

Salvini

Matteo Salvini, leader of Italy's Lega party.
World
Live Story

Dozens of leaky, overcrowded boats have arrived in and around Italy's Lampedusa in recent days from North Africa, some landing directly and others requiring

The New Arab Staff & Agencies
04 August, 2022